Silent on the evening of the national holiday, Emmanuel Macron finally spoke to the French on Monday July 24. From Nouméa, in New Caledonia, where he has just landed for a tour of Oceania, the President of the Republic granted an interview, in duplex, to the 1 p.m. newspapers of TF1 and France 2, to close the parenthesis of the hundred days that he had granted himself on March 22 in order to“appease” the country, after the crisis caused by the pension reform.

Ten days have passed since the appointment initially set for July 14 and more than 16,000 kilometers separate the Head of State from Paris, but the President of the Republic proves that he “keep your word”defends one of its strategists.

In the heart of summer, after his words on Friday, addressed to the ministers of a freshly reshuffled government, a “1 p.m.” allows to speak “to French people who watch TV”assures the Elysée, not doubting an audience success.

After the hesitation of the last few weeks concerning the future of his Prime Minister, Elisabeth Borne, who was finally kept in office on Monday, Emmanuel Macron assures us that he has opted for “confidence, continuity and efficiency “. But without quite dispelling the impression that this is a default choice. Praising his own action, more than that of the head of government, he talks about his “decisions and his travels – from « Perols [Hérault] in Vendome [Loir-et-Cher], from Serre-Ponçon [Hautes-Alpes] in Paris, from Marseille to Strasbourg” – to illustrate the success of this period.

“Small Revolutions”

“Remember, a hundred days ago, we were told that the country would be at a standstill and that there would no longer be a trip without pots! », welcomes the Head of State, listing the projects launched, relaunched or highlighted – full employment and reindustrialisation, ecology with the decarbonisation of industry, the revival of nuclear power, the water plan to deal with drought, or the increase in budgets for justice and the armies. And he insists on education, “huge construction site”, whose portfolio is now held by Gabriel Attal. Coming alive at the mention of the teacher pact, allowing teachers to be better paid, Emmanuel Macron promises that at the start of the school year, each student will have a teacher in front of him.

“It’s a series of small revolutions”, which will be put in place, he continues, recalling the announcements made, in particular, during his trip to Marseille at the end of June, such as the reception of children from 2 years old at school in neighborhoods in difficulty, the opening from 8 a.m. to 6 p.m. of colleges in sensitive areas, half an hour of systematic sport in primary school or the reform of vocational high schools. He also sketches the “common sense changes” which will have to improve the baccalaureate reform and Parcoursup so that the student orientation platform no longer looks like a “machine that delivers results”.
